A week ago, La Nazione reported Fiorentina want to sign Chelsea’s Cesare Casadei but are ‘far away’ from meeting the Premier League side’s €20m request.

The midfielder was on loan at Leicester City last season, where he made only eight league starts under Enzo Maresca’s orders. The manager has taken over at the west London club, but the 21-year-old is unlikely to be included in his plans next season.

That’s according to Calciomercato, who say the player is training alone and waiting to leave Chelsea.

The Italy U21 international has received approaches from the Premier League. The report hasn’t provided the names of those clubs, and it’s claimed the player isn’t considering them because his priority is to make a switch to Serie A.

Fiorentina and Torino have shown interest, with La Viola ahead.

It’s claimed Fiorentina’s idea is to take Casadei on loan, probably by including an option to buy or a conditional purchase obligation. In order to convince Chelsea to sanction a loan move, the Serie A side are willing to cover the midfielder’s full salary.

Calciomercato state Fiorentina held talks last week, likely with the Italian’s camp, and will hold fresh talks again in the ‘next few days’.

Casadei feels a move to Serie A could improve his chances of representing Italy’s senior team, and this is one of the reasons he hasn’t considered joining another Premier League side.
